NOVELTY - Graphene infrared radiating paint comprises 20-45 wt.% film-forming resin, 1-10 wt.% graphene, 30-50 wt.% infrared radiation function one-dimensional nanomaterials, 1.5-5 wt.% hard functional auxiliary filler and 0-3 wt.% resin curing agent. USE - Used as graphene infrared radiating paint. ADVANTAGE - Graphene infrared radiating paint exihibits synergistic effect, has high emissivity and thermal conductivity coefficient and excellent abrasion resistance and scratch resistance. DETAILED DESCRIPTION - An INDEPENDENT CLAIM is also included for preparation of graphene infrared radiating paint comprising weighing all raw materials of components, carrying out ball milling treatment of infrared radiation function of one-dimensional nanomaterials, graphene and hard-functional auxiliary filler to obtain a composite infrared functional nano-filler, dissolving the film-forming resin in a solvent and mixing with composite infrared functional nano-filler, and then performing viscosity adjustment treatment to obtain graphene infrared radiating paint heat mixed slurry, and then packaging resin curing agent and heat mixed slurry.
